REUTERS/Jim Urquhart(Reuters) – Here is a selection of communications Stewart Rhodes and his associates had in the lead-up and aftermath of the attack on the U.S. Capitol on Jan. 6, 2021. According to prosecutors who charged Rhodes and 10 other members with seditious conspiracies on Thursday.
NOVEMBER 2020
Indictment states that Rhodes (of Granbury, Texas) started to disseminate messages via encrypted applications to his supporters in November 2020. This encouraged them “oppose the lawful transfer presidency power by force.”
He sent an email on November 5, just two days after his election. It stated: “We won’t get through this without a Civil War.” It’s too late. Get ready to prepare your body and spirit.”
DECEMBER 2020
Rhodes, on Dec. 11, sent a message through Signal to an invite-only chat group. He said that Democrat Joe Biden would take over the presidency and it would be a “bloody and desperate battle.” There will be a fight. It cannot be avoided.
On Christmas Day, Rhodes wrote that Congress would likely “screw” then-President Donald Trump over and the only chance he has is if “we scare the shit out of them and convince them it will be torches and pitchforks…”
JAN. 6, 2021
Rhodes stated that Vice President Mike “Pence” was doing nothing just before 1:30 PM on the morning of the attack. As I predicted.”
Trump is just complaining, he said. He has no intention to do anything. Therefore, the patriots take matters into their own hands. They are fed up.
Rhodes said that people who came to the Capitol weren’t members of Antifa. This is a loosely organized antifascism organization. Rhodes, who was a member of the mobs attacking the Capitol’s Capitol building, replied “Actual Patriots.” They are pissed off patriots. Pissed off patriots, just like the Sons of Liberty.
